Double Hung
Windows

The double-hung window style has two sashes that open vertically for ventilation from either the top or bottom of the window unit. Both sashes may tilt in for safe and easy cleaning from inside the home. Balancers counter the weight of the sashes to provide easy operation and to allow the sashes to remain open in any position.

Choosing Your
Double Hung Windows

Double hung windows are a popular choice for homeowners due to their classic style and versatile functionality. One of the standout features of double-hung windows is their ability to open from both the top and the bottom, which not only improves ventilation but also enhances safety, as the upper sash can be opened while keeping the lower one closed, ideal for homes with children and pets.
